What metal materials do you recommend for marine or chemical environments?
For high corrosion resistance, we highly recommend 316L Stainless Steel. For applications requiring extreme high temperature strength and chemical inertness, Inconel 718 is an excellent choice. Our Instant Quote Tool provides material options and their properties.
Do you offer post-processing for metal 3D printed parts?
Yes, we offer comprehensive post-processing for metal parts, including heat treatment (stress relief, HIP), machining, and various surface finishes. These services ensure your parts meet the exact specifications required for their demanding applications in the petrochemical, energy, and marine industries. Our Team
JawsTec was founded in 2017 by Oscar Klassen and is headquartered in American Falls, ID. They purpose to hire recent high school graduated from local schools in rural Idaho and teach them about manufacturing and production development. JawsTec’s team has grown to over 30 employees and they look to expand even more as they aim to be one of the leading 3D printing and fabrication services around the globe.
